Output 7839ee71ffce119547566cd53b34526670a097d19510d3ba61afc34d19658a7b:3

value
21588202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8715bf1170a9a1227631a72c7aec258ada395d76 OP_EQUAL
address
MLDRWHpjJfRreJK1w9MupL9mHJ4wv5KHub
transaction
7839ee71ffce119547566cd53b34526670a097d19510d3ba61afc34d19658a7b
spent
true